Dodgers host Holiday Party for local children

LOS ANGELES -- The Dodgers and the Los Angeles Dodgers Foundation hosted more than 300 pre-selected schoolchildren from the community at the annual Children's Holiday Party at Dodger Stadium on Friday.

Current Dodgers Hyun-Jin Ryu and Justin Turner took time out from their rehabs from surgeries to join former Dodgers Matt Luke, Tim Leary, Kenny Landreaux and Dennis Powell in autograph signings and photo opportunities.

The event included a mini-luge run set up in the parking lot, with snow provided by Arctic Glacier Ice. Levy Restaurants provided lunch, children received a new pair of Skechers shoes and Mattel Children's Foundation donated toys.

The participating neighborhood schools were Clifford Street Elementary School, Logan Span School, Sunrise Elementary School, Florence Griffith Joyner Elementary School, Grape Street Elementary School, Florence Nightingale Middle School, Thomas Starr King Middle School and Irving Middle School. Ann Street Elementary School and Soto Elementary School were not able to attend the event, which was rescheduled from an earlier date.
